Trophy dream could come true for Elsburg

Elsburg Rugby Club beat Delmas in their Kestrel League semi-final on Saturday.

Elsburg Rugby Club triumphed in what was an extremely physical semi-final match at the Elspark Sports Grounds, on Saturday.

The local men took on Delmas in the Kestrel League and walked away the victors with a score line of 18-10.

The team will face Eden Park in the final at 11am, this Saturday, at Barnard Stadium in Kempton Park.

Although there seemed to be a number of complaints, from both teams, about many of the referee’s decisions, Elsburg played strong rugby with most of the action being in the Delmas half.

The team were elated with their win and are looking forward to contesting for the trophy.

The try scorers for Elsburg were Pierre Bezuidenhout with two tries and Damian Diedericks with one.

Rudie Wessels kicked a successful penalty shot.
